Hormone Replacement Therapy Market: Comprehensive Analysis (2024-2035)

Market Overview

The Global Hormone Replacement Therapy Market is valued at USD 22.6 Billion in 2023 and is projected to reach a value of USD 40.3 Billion by 2032 at a CAGR (Compound Annual Growth Rate) of 7.5% between 2024 and 2032.  Hormone Replacement Therapy (HRT) refers to the medical treatment that involves supplementing the body with hormones to restore hormonal balance. HRT is primarily used for managing symptoms associated with hormonal imbalances, especially during menopause, and other conditions like hypothyroidism, gender dysphoria, and osteoporosis. This therapy aims to improve quality of life by alleviating symptoms like hot flashes, night sweats, mood swings, and low energy, which are common during menopause.

Key Product Types and Characteristics

HRT is typically divided into the following categories:

  • Estrogen Therapy: Used primarily to treat menopause-related symptoms by supplementing estrogen levels.
  • Progesterone Therapy: Often combined with estrogen to protect the uterine lining in women who have not undergone a hysterectomy.
  • Combination Therapy: A combination of estrogen and progesterone is commonly used.
  • Testosterone Therapy: Used in specific cases for women with low testosterone levels, including those with sexual dysfunction.
  • Bioidentical Hormone Replacement Therapy (BHRT): A customized version using hormones that are chemically identical to those produced by the human body.

Primary Uses

The primary uses of HRT include managing menopause symptoms, preventing osteoporosis, treating hypothyroidism, and aiding in gender transition for transgender individuals.

Key Market Trends

The HRT market has witnessed several emerging trends in recent years, driven by evolving healthcare demands, advancements in technology, and changing consumer behaviors.

Technological Advancements

Innovations in drug delivery systems and advancements in personalized medicine have revolutionized HRT. For instance, transdermal patches, oral tablets, and even subcutaneous implants have improved the delivery of hormones, leading to better patient compliance and outcomes.

Sustainability and Eco-Friendly Trends

Sustainability has become a key focus in healthcare. The HRT industry is seeing a rise in demand for eco-friendly packaging, plant-based estrogen alternatives, and manufacturing processes that reduce environmental impact.

Consumer Behavior Shifts

Consumers are becoming increasingly informed about their healthcare choices. This has led to a rise in demand for natural and bioidentical hormones, as opposed to synthetic hormone therapies. Additionally, the preference for non-invasive treatment options, like topical creams and patches, is growing due to their convenience and reduced side effects.

Pricing Trends

Pricing in the Hormone Replacement Therapy market varies widely depending on the product type, region, and brand. Traditional therapies, such as oral tablets and patches, are generally priced lower than bioidentical hormone treatments. For example, a basic estrogen tablet could range from $30 to $80 per month, while bioidentical hormone therapy might cost $100 to $200 or more per month.

Historical Pricing Trends

Over the past decade, the pricing of synthetic hormone therapies has remained relatively stable. However, with the increasing demand for natural and bioidentical hormones, there has been a rise in prices for these alternatives. Additionally, newer delivery mechanisms like implants and subdermal patches can be more expensive than traditional options.

Projected Pricing

The future pricing of HRT products is expected to see an increase due to factors such as inflation, innovation in drug formulations, and the growing preference for personalized therapies.
